Os resultados apontam que o excesso de atividades e o desgaste emocional a que os docentes estão sujeitos no trabalho os tornam mais susceptíveis e vulneráveis ao desenvolvimento de transtornos relacionados ao estresse. ABSTRACTThe stressful conditions faced in the teacher's daily routine can lead to an imbalance between work and physical and mental health, resulting in the development of stress, like Burnout Syndrome - SB. Therefore, this study sought, in the literature, the relations between stress and teaching work. The present study is about a review of the integrative type. The results pointed to several issues around stress. Thus two categories were formed covering Bournout Syndrome and Other Disorders. The results indicate that the excess of activities and the emotional exhaustion that the teachers are subject to at work make them more susceptible and vulnerable to the development of stress-related disorders. KEY WORDS: stress - teacher work - teacher.

The author reveals in the article the concept of stress of its determinant in women who are expecting a child, the possible consequences for a child who during the intrauterine development has been exposed to stress. Classic ones are considered and the newest methods of psycho-prevention, psycho-correction of stressful conditions in women during pregnancy and childbirth are presented. The advantages and disadvantages of nonclassical methods of psycho-prevention and psycho-correction of stress in women bearing a child are determined. Numerous recent studies demonstrate the important role of the prenatal period in the formation of obesity, hypertension and carbohydrate tolerance impairment in adulthood. The article presents the literature and our own data on the hormonal and epigenetic mechanisms of this diseases. Antenatal and postnatal markers of intrauterine programming were described.
